The way glucocorticoids affect TSH-releasing hormone TRH mRNA expression in the paraventricular nucleus (PVN) of the hypothalamus is still unclear. In view of its relevance for Cushing's syndrome and depression we measured TRH mRNA expression in human hypothalami obtained at autopsy by means of quantitative TRH mRNA in situ hybridization. In corticosteroid treated subjects (n = 10), TRH mRNA hybridization signal was decreased as compared with matched control subjects (n = 10)(Mann-Whitney U, P = 0.02). By inference, hypercortisolism as present in patients with Cushing's syndrome or major depression may contribute to lower serum TSH or to symptoms of depression by lowering hypothalamic TRH expression.
